TENSAS WATER DISTRICT ASSOCIATION (PWSID LA1107009) is a cws water system drawing from a surface water source, regulated by the EPA Safe Drinking Water Information System (SDWIS) under the Safe Drinking Water Act. It serves approximately 3,843 people in St Joseph, LA, and is subject to primacy enforcement by the Louisiana drinking-water program.

The system's federal compliance record contains 25 total violations, with 25 classified as health-based (MCL exceedances or treatment-technique failures). 2 distinct contaminants have been cited, including Turbidity, Arsenic. Recorded violations span 2020–2025.

A historical violation does not necessarily describe current water quality, systems must notify customers and remediate, and monitoring-type violations often reflect reporting lapses rather than contamination. The most authoritative real-time source is the utility's annual Consumer Confidence Report. For enforcement history and corrective-action orders, consult EPA ECHO and the Louisiana state drinking-water program's public portal.
